Transaction 160ab9060226b887415f8457dd6a592c462effd70df32dc16110c48eacf82c14
1 Input
1 Output
-
160ab9060226b887415f8457dd6a592c462effd70df32dc16110c48eacf82c14:0
- value
- 643512
- script pubkey
- OP_0 OP_PUSHBYTES_20 a1ffd1535797df318559773b1bede9ec02322aae
- address
- bc1q58laz56hjl0nrp2ewua3hm0faspry24w90fz9w